In a world where the strong devour the weak, Su Han was once a shining star—until his Dantian was shattered and his father vanished into thin air. Reduced to a 'cripple' and mocked by his own clan, he lived a life of humiliation... until a soul from Earth merged with his body. ​【AWAKENING: THE INVINCIBLE SUPREME DRAGON SYSTEM】 ​The game changes now. No Dantian? No problem. He gains experience from killing even an ant! But the system is just the beginning. Deep within his veins, a legendary power stirs—THE INVINCIBLE SUPREME DRAGON BLOODLINE. ​From alchemy and smithing to the legendary Supreme Golden Dragon Sword, Su Han now holds the keys to the heavens. ​— HE WILL RISE FROM THE ASHES. — HE WILL CRUSH HIS ENEMIES. — HE WILL RECLAIM THE THRONE. ​As the ultimate Sovereign of the Dragon Era, if the heavens block his path, he will tear the heavens apart!

Chapter 1 - Chapter 1: System Awakening: The Rise of Su Han

​In a room that felt more like a decaying tomb than a living space, a sixteen-year-old boy lay motionless on a hard, wooden bed.

​The air was thick with the scent of damp earth and rotting wood.

​Suddenly, his eyes snapped open, and he bolted upright with a blood-curdling scream that echoed off the cracked, grimy walls.

​His chest heaved as he gasped for air, his heart drumming a frantic rhythm against his ribs.

​But as the echoes died down, a chilling silence took over, and his confusion turned into pure shock.

​The last thing he remembered was a world of asphalt and neon.

​He had been on his way to meet his girlfriend at their secret spot—a place where the world felt soft and safe.

​But that safety had been shattered when men in black masks emerged from the shadows like predators.

​He had fled into the depths of a dense forest, branches clawing at his skin, until he reached the edge of a jagged cliff.

​With the thugs closing in and no way out, he had ground his teeth in defiance and plummeted into the abyss.

​He remembered the bone-crushing impact against a massive black rock before everything went dark.

​Now, he was here. He scanned his surroundings, but nothing made sense.

​This was an ancient, primitive room. No wires, no screens, no hum of electricity.

​Just as he tried to process this, a searing pain tore through his skull, as if a red-hot needle was stitching new memories into his brain.

​He realized with a jolt that he had transmigrated.

​This world was massive—hundreds of times larger than Earth—and governed by the law of the jungle.

​Here, technology was a myth, and personal power was the only currency.

​The body he now inhabited belonged to Su Han, the fallen heir of the Su Clan.

​Two years ago, Su Han had been a cultivation prodigy, a rising star destined for greatness.

​But a mysterious attacker had shattered his Dantian, destroying his path to power.

​Shortly after, his father had vanished into the unknown while searching for a cure, leaving Su Han defenseless.

​The once-honored Young Master was now a pariah, discarded like trash in this broken shack.

​He was mocked and beaten by those who used to flatter him.

​BAM!

​The fragile door was kicked open with such force that it nearly flew off its hinges.

​A stout boy with eyes full of arrogance swaggered in. This was Su Xiao.

​He looked at Su Han with a sneer that twisted his fatty face.

​"Hey, trash! I gave you my boots to polish this morning. Where are they? Bring them here now!"

​His tone was foul, treating the Young Master like a common slave.

​In the past, Su Xiao would have crawled on the ground just for a nod from Su Han.

​But now that Su Han's father was gone, the boy had become a loyal dog to the Great Elder's son.

​Su Han looked at him with icy eyes, his voice steady despite the pain.

​"I am not your servant."

​Su Xiao barked out a laugh.

​"It seems you've forgotten the beating I gave you last time. Maybe your skin is itching for another lesson?"

​As the bully stepped forward, a girl rushed into the room.

​She was Chu Yao, Su Han's personal maid.

​She had been with him since childhood, brought home by his father years ago.

​She was the only person who hadn't turned her back on him.

​"Young Master! You're finally awake!" she cried out, her voice trembling.

​She immediately stepped in front of Su Han, shielding him with her own body.

​She turned to Su Xiao, her eyes flashing with a mix of fear and anger.

​"Master Su Xiao, please leave! The Young Master is still recovering from his injuries. Do not disturb him!"

​Su Xiao didn't listen. Instead, he licked his lips as his gaze crawled over Chu Yao.

​She was sixteen, slender and beautiful, with hair tied in twin ponytails and eyes as sharp as a phoenix's.

​Even in her simple maid's clothes, her fair skin glowed.

​"I'll let your pathetic master go," Su Xiao said, his voice dropping to a predatory whisper.

​"But what's in it for me? I've liked you for a long time, Chu Yao."

​"Why don't you 'take care' of me today? If you do, I might stop bothering this piece of trash."

​Without waiting for an answer, he reached out a greasy hand to stroke her cheek.

​Chu Yao recoiled in disgust, her face turning pale.

​Su Xiao's expression darkened instantly.

​"Don't test my patience. This is for your own good—and his."

​He reached for her clothes this time.

​Chu Yao tried to slap his hand away, but she was a weak girl with no cultivation.

​Su Xiao, a Level 2 Body Refiner, easily caught her wrist.

​"You little bitch, you don't know what's good for you!"

​SLAP!

​The sound was sharp and violent.

​Chu Yao was sent sprawling to the floor, a vivid red handprint blooming on her porcelain cheek.

​Tears welled in her eyes, but she didn't make a sound.

​Seeing the girl who had protected him for years being treated like this triggered something deep inside Su Han.

​A primal rage, fueled by both his old soul and the memories of this body, exploded.

​"HOW DARE YOU!" Su Han screamed, launching himself off the bed.

​He forgot his shattered Dantian; he forgot his weakness. He just wanted to kill.

​Su Xiao laughed, a mocking sound.

​"A cripple wants to play hero?"

​As Su Han lunged, Su Xiao planted a heavy kick squarely into Su Han's chest.

​The impact felt like being hit by a speeding truck.

​Su Han was hurled backward, slamming into the stone wall.

​Blood sprayed from his mouth, and his vision began to blur.

​Just as he felt his consciousness slipping, a cold, mechanical voice resonated inside his soul:

​[DING! Congratulations to the Host for awakening the Invincible Supreme Dragon System!]

​[DING! Host has accidentally killed an ant! Gained 10 Experience Points and 5 Silver Coins!]

​[DING! Host has gained a Common-Grade Skill: "Tear Apart with Teeth"!]

​[DING! First-time awakening bonus: 100 Experience Points and 100 Silver Coins granted!]

​[DING! Alchemy Sub-profession unlocked!]

​[DING! Weapon Smithing Sub-profession unlocked!]

​[DING! Puppet Mastery Sub-profession unlocked!]

​[DING! Talisman Crafting Sub-profession unlocked!]

​[DING! Host has received 1/5th of the Divine Artifact: Supreme Golden Dragon Sword!]

​[DING! Host has successfully broken through to Level 1 Body Refining Realm!]

​The flood of notifications made Su Han's head spin for a second.

​A wild, predatory smile spread across his bloodied lips.

​"Is this it? My 'Golden Finger'?"

​His eyes sharpened as he looked at Su Xiao, who was already turning back toward the trembling Chu Yao.

​Su Han glanced at the system skill: Tear Apart with Teeth? "What am I, a dog?" He shook his head.

​He was now at Level 1, while Su Xiao was Level 2, but the system had healed his core.

​Su Han's hand crept toward the side table, grabbing a small, sharp fruit knife.

​While Su Xiao was distracted, Su Han's movements became a blur.

​He wasn't just a cripple anymore.

​With a surge of newfound strength, he drove the knife deep into Su Xiao's backside—right between the buttocks.

​"ARGHHH!" Su Xiao let out a high-pitched shriek, spinning around in agony.

​He tried to throw a punch at Su Han's chest, but Su Han was ready.

​He ducked the blow and, before Su Xiao could pull the knife out, Su Han delivered a brutal kick directly to the bully's crotch.

​Su Xiao collapsed to his knees, his face turning a sickly shade of purple.

​He couldn't even scream; only a strangled wheeze escaped his throat.

​Su Han didn't give him a second to breathe.

​He stepped forward and delivered a crushing kick to Su Xiao's face, sending him tumbling across the floor.

​Su Han walked over, his footsteps heavy and deliberate, and pressed his foot firmly onto Su Xiao's throat.

​"Let... let me go..." Su Xiao gasped, his eyes bulging with terror.

​"Young Master Su Chen won't... won't let you live for this..."

​Su Han's smile was terrifying.

​"You seem to have forgotten, you piece of filth... I am the Young Master."

​"Anyone who recognizes someone else is a rebel."

​Without a hint of mercy, Su Han shifted his weight and pressed down with all his might.

​CRACK!

​The sound of snapping bone filled the room.

​Su Xiao's eyes went wide, his head twisted at an unnatural angle, and the light faded from his pupils.

​The bully was dead.
